Near infrared palm image acquisition and two-finger valley point-based image extraction for palm vascular pattern detection
Human palm vascular pattern is one of biometric modality that can be used for authentication purpose. It is concealed under the skin and unseen through human visual in visible light spectrum. To enable visibility of palm vascular pattern, additional illumination from near infrared (NIR) light is...
